A code-writing aid for changing Odoo data or database structures during an upgrade. Odoo is business software whose records are stored in a database; migrations move or reshape those records safely.

In plain words
What is it for?
Use it to write scripts for renaming fields, changing data types, splitting or merging models, filling in missing data, and transforming module data.
Why use it?
It helps prevent data loss and inconsistent records when fields, models, or stored values change. It also provides checks and a rollback note, but does not run the migration on a live database.

Role

Developer / Data Engineer - writes safe, idempotent Odoo migration scripts. Prioritizes data integrity above all else: parameterized SQL only, explicit transaction boundaries, verifiable row counts, and a rollback note in every output.


Out of Scope

Topic Skill to use instead
API deprecation scan before upgrade odoo-deprecation-audit
What changed between two Odoo versions odoo-version-diff
Deploy readiness gate odoo-deploy-checklist
Full upgrade orchestration plan /odoo-plan-upgrade
Backend model/field creation (no migration needed) odoo-coding
Executive risk overview odoo-risk-overview

IMPORTANT - execution boundary. This skill WRITES the migration script. It does NOT execute the migration against any live database. Running the migration is a separate, human-gated step that belongs in the deploy pipeline (see odoo-deploy-checklist Domain 3 and docs/reference/INSTANCE-LIFECYCLE.md § -i vs -u semantics); when it is run via odoo-bin -u <module>, the interpreter is resolved per snippets/venv-resolution.md (the matching instance's python field), not system python3. Never claim or imply that invoking this skill migrates any real data.


MCP tools

Pick the right tool first. Odoo Semantic (the odoo-semantic-mcp server) is the INDEXED Odoo source-code knowledge graph: a pre-built graph + vector index of Odoo source across every indexed Odoo version (legacy through latest) and repos/editions, with inheritance, override, and cross-module impact already resolved. It gives AUTHORITATIVE STRUCTURAL facts about how Odoo source IS DEFINED, with no local checkout needed. Unique signature: indexed, cross-version, inheritance-resolved, whole-graph, checkout-free. It is a STATIC index with NO runtime/live data.

This is your PRIMARY, context-efficient source for Odoo source/structure questions - the Odoo codebase is huge and reading it directly burns context, so prefer Odoo Semantic first. Order of precedence: (1) Odoo Semantic available -> use it; (2) available but it lacks the specific detail -> THEN read the source (Read/Grep your checkout) to fill that gap; (3) unavailable -> read the source. Reading code is the FALLBACK, never the first move when Odoo Semantic can answer.

Do NOT use Odoo Semantic for:

  • LIVE DATA / runtime - actual record values, search/read/write real records, executing a method, this instance's installed modules -> use a live Odoo MCP server (one exposing read_record/search_records/execute_method), NOT Odoo Semantic.

Look-live-but-static tools (return indexed source, never runtime data): model_inspect, module_inspect, entity_lookup, validate_domain, validate_depends, validate_relation, describe_module, check_module_exists, resolve_orm_chain. These tool names look like they query a live instance but return indexed source data only. If you need live records, Odoo Semantic is the wrong server.
